The Visionary Legacy of Frits Lugt

The soul of this institution resides in the lifelong passion of Frits Lugt, a man whose name is synonymous with the meticulous study of Northern European art. Alongside his wife, Jacoba Klever, Lugt transformed a personal obsession into a lasting cultural legacy. Established in 1947, the Fondation Custodia was born from a desire to preserve not just objects, but the very essence of artistic discovery. Lugt’s expertise—particularly his unparalleled authority on the etchings of Rembrandt—infused the collection with a sense of scholarly rigor that remains palpable today. The museum stands as a testament to his dedication, embodying a spirit where research and genuine appreciation for beauty exist in perfect harmony.

The Intimacy of the Graphic Masterpiece

While many museums celebrate the monumental, the Frits Lugt Collection finds its heartbeat in the subtle and the small. The collection boasts an extraordinary wealth of over 7,000 Old Master drawings and 15,000 prints, offering a window into the raw, creative impulses of history’s greatest minds. Here, one can witness the preparatory sketches that preceded legendary oil paintings, capturing the fleeting moment of inspiration before it was formalized by pigment. From the masterful chiaroscuro of Dutch masters like Rembrandt and Samuel van Hoogstraten to the delicate French sensibilities of Antoine Watteau and Claude Lorrain, the collection charts a breathtaking evolution of technique. For collectors and art lovers, these works represent more than mere historical artifacts; they are intimate encounters with the hand of the artist, where every stroke of a quill or bite of an etching needle tells a story of profound human emotion and technical brilliance.
